Compassion FA finish as runners-up at Inspire Cup


MARGAO

Compassion FA, Goa finished runners up in the third edition and were unable to make it three in a row in the La Liga Foundacion, Bank of Baroda sponsored 3rd Inspire Cup All India inter academies girls U-17 football tournament, organised by the RDT’s Anantpur Sports Academy in Andhra Pradesh.

Compassion FA playing for 5 days on a trot lost a closely fought first match against Anantpur Sports Academy from Andhra Pradesh comprising most of the state team players and a few knocking on the door of the Indian national team. Compassion lost 0-3 in the final match and had to be content with the runners up trophy.

In the previous two editions they had overcome the same team and lifted the coveted trophy. Compassion FC’s India prospects Fatima Braganza and Pearl Fernandes as expected were declared the best player and highest scorer of the tournament awards in a tournament which had 8 selected academy teams from Tamil Nadu, Rajasthan, Andhra Pradesh, Telangana, Gujarat and Goa.

The Goan team were off colour having played the ASA on several occasions in the recent past and the key players Pearl, Fatima and Riya were completely bottled up by the hosts knowing well the strategies and strengths of Compassion team. Four of the Goan players who did not accompany the team because of their SSC exams preparation were also missing in the squad which made a difference in the end.

However, Compassion FC’s team also playing in a four a side festival also picked up the winners prize.

Riya Patre (Captain), Fatima Braganza, Ria Rajesh, Pearl Fernandes, Amelie Nazareth, Shaundelle Gomes, Valanca Fernandes, Keya Borwankar, Gretchen Vaz, Sarita Chhetri, Prachita Gaonkar, Moncy Vaz, Pushpanjali Huddar, Gauri Hulikavi, Geuel D’Souza, Shaheen Alatgiri, Jolin Fernandes and Melriya Fernandes

The team management consisted of Prakash Khatri (Coach), Sanjay Pillarisett ( Assistant Coach), Brigid D’Souza (Manager), Syloney Fernandes (Assistant Manager).
